Monarch’s Supply Drops represent exclusive military-grade containers introduced during Fortnite’s Godzilla crossover event. These specialized crates contain enhanced weaponry and resources that can significantly boost your combat effectiveness.
As part of Hope’s Godzilla questline, players must locate and open two of these distinctive supply containers. The loot pool differs from standard supply drops, featuring a probability of containing the powerful Rail Gun weapon. However, their tendency to land in exposed locations makes them hotspots for player confrontation and requires careful tactical planning to secure safely.

The appearance mechanism for Monarch’s Supply Drops follows specific kaiju-based triggers that determine both timing and location. Understanding these patterns is crucial for efficient farming.
King Kong manifests during the initial battle bus phase, while Godzilla emerges as the first storm circle begins contracting. Immediately upon either creature’s arrival, access your map to identify the distinctive Monarch emblem resembling an angled hourglass symbol. Each marked location corresponds to one supply container that you can approach and open rapidly.
Advanced players should note that Godzilla encounters typically offer superior farming opportunities. Drops materialize the moment Godzilla’s portal appears and continue descending throughout the engagement, whereas King Kong zones experience higher player concentration and competition. For optimal results, prioritize matches where Godzilla spawns to maximize your chances of securing multiple containers with reduced opposition.
Successfully acquiring Monarch’s Supply Drops requires more than simple navigation—it demands strategic foresight and risk management. These high-value containers attract immediate attention from nearby opponents, creating intense firefight scenarios.
Before approaching a marked location, conduct thorough environmental assessment. Identify nearby cover, escape routes, and potential ambush points. Consider landing at elevated positions that provide overwatch of the drop zone, allowing you to monitor enemy activity before committing to the retrieval.
Team coordination dramatically improves success rates. Designate one member as security while others handle the collection. Establish clear communication protocols for enemy sightings and extraction procedures. Solo players should utilize mobility items like Shockwave Grenades or vehicles for rapid approach and escape capabilities.
The Rail Gun’s presence in the loot pool justifies the risk, but never prioritize loot over survival. Sometimes the smarter strategy involves allowing other players to secure the drop first, then engaging them while they’re vulnerable during the looting animation.
Completing Hope’s Godzilla assignment requires opening two Monarch’s Supply Drops, which can be accomplished efficiently with proper planning. The most reliable method involves targeting Godzilla encounters, as the continuous drop spawns provide multiple opportunities within a single match.
Avoid these common mistakes: don’t immediately open drops upon arrival (check for nearby threats first), don’t ignore the storm circle’s movement (drops often spawn near evolving safe zones), and don’t underestimate the travel time between drop locations when planning multiple collections.
For players struggling with the challenge, consider these alternative approaches: utilize stealth-based loadouts to avoid detection, employ fishing rods to obtain mobility items for faster traversal, or focus on Team Rumble modes where respawns allow for repeated attempts. Most experienced players complete this quest within 2-4 matches when applying these optimized strategies.
